Many local dog owners attended the RUFF monthly meeting held last week at the Nazzaro Community Center.
The community group also held a park and playground monthly clean-up last Sunday morning starting at the Prado. The next clean-up project will be held on Sunday, March 24, same time, same meeting place.
RUFF is working with the North End Spaulding Rehab Center to have local dog owners meet with patients on a regular basis. The group hopes to begin this neighborhood program this March 2013.
The group recently held a successful Doggie Play Date, hosted by the Dog Father which provided refreshments.
A March 8 sit-down/takeout restaurant fundraiser has been tentatively scheduled. Time and place to be announced.
RUFF conducted a survey asking many questions relating to the group’s activities. Results are available online.
A social event (line event) possible wine tasting has been scheduled tentatively for March 22. Time and place to be announced.
The group is discussing possible activities, programs and events with the North End Library, mostly education programs.
RUFF members were advised of a major American Cancer Society Bark For Life, a canine event to fight cancer, being held at the Boston Common on June 2 from 1-3pm.
Talks of one or two dog parks in the North End have been stalled by inclement weather.
The next RUFF monthly meeting will be held on Tuesday, March 19 at 7pm in the Nazzaro Community Center.
